Transaction cfdfccbf7c416bfa0102d559642566aaadb874f86d392257790f0cc39b1374e4
1 Input
1 Output
-
cfdfccbf7c416bfa0102d559642566aaadb874f86d392257790f0cc39b1374e4:0
- value
- 527007
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 431dbfb73fece4071fd136003f6698ef30f10dd6 OP_EQUAL
- address
- 37otqPK5NreccgxUHcYXrJ6ZM3PSDsUUos